• Another great trip to Skiatook

    Wed, Oct 05, 2005 After the morning storms we went up to Keystone to get bait and met clients at Tall Chief around 2 PM. We immediately got into some good sized Hybrids in Tall Chief Cove before we even got out into the lake. It was pretty windy so we anchored up on a spot where we had caught several. We fished there for a couple of hours until the fish moved out. There was topwater action all over the place all afternoon but we stayed on the bigger fish with 3 inch shad on down lines. All fish were caught in the lower end of the lake. We ended up with 15 Brids, 10 Sandies and one worn out 11 year old boy. It was a good trip, the fall bite is definitely on at Skiatook
